Arrival time

The new arrival time for this site is now 1pm - which is fine if everyone stuck to this new rule. But it seems if you arrive early you will still get on. When we were there we saw a caravan get on at 11.40am - twenty minutes before the old time. If those that obey the new rule stay away until 1pm they will have missed all the good pitches. I think it should have been off at 11.30 and on at 12.30. That said its our favourite site.

 

Message from The Club:

The new arrivals time is from 1pm and departures by 12pm to enable safe passage along our restricted access road.  Before new arrivals are allowed on site from 1pm, existing visitors may wish to change pitch to one which suites their needs better, especially when we are full and have had limited options the afternoon before.  It is also normal for visitors who were unable to arrive on site prior to 8pm the previous evening to use the Late Nights Arrival area and on checking in the following morning to then move onto pitches as they become vacant.  Outfits who have arrived prior to the 1pm arrivals time are asked to wait in the arrivals area.  We hope this clears up any misunderstanding.  Thank you.

A great forest retreat

We stayed here for four nights and thoroughly enjoyed our stay. The site is set in a wooded area with pitches amongst the trees. Very quiet and picturesque. The staff were helpful and the toilet blocks were very clean. There was the added bonus of the fish and chip van every Friday night. The local area was excellent being close to Windermere, Ambleside and Grange over Sands. All well worth a visit. We would go back to this site again.
